摘 要:文章以三代华龙堆型核电站蒸汽发生器管板锻件为研究对象,通过分析管板锻件材料采购规范和要求的变化,探讨超大直径厚饼类锻件的制造工艺难点。研究制订出合理的冶炼和锻造工艺方案,控制其工艺要点,使制造厂能够按照既定的工艺生产出满足设计、采购及相应规范要求的合格锻件,以期加快我国三代堆型核电站核岛关键部件的国产化进程。In this paper, the tube sheet forgings of steam generators in the third generation Hualong reactor type nuclear power plant are taken as the research object. By analyzing the changes in material procurement specifications and requirements for tube sheet forgings, the manufacturing process difficulties of super-large diameter thick cake forgings are discussed. It studies and formulates a reasonable smelting and forging process plan and controls the key points of the process, so that the manufacturer can produce qualified forgings that meet the requirements of design, procurement and corresponding specifications according to the established process, hoping to speed up the localization process of key components of nuclear islands in China’s third generation nuclear power plants.
